Output 8fc8e7b750af27c4266cfa59e404018a61f719f7ec7fd653a26f9bb9ecb10b37:5

value
340629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1c718eef111910dd4c69bef3fad20bcfd11d81 OP_EQUAL
address
3ABLqgLefrR1foSTw48RTdnu9JTTTwuX3e
transaction
8fc8e7b750af27c4266cfa59e404018a61f719f7ec7fd653a26f9bb9ecb10b37
confirmations
150210
spent
true